Modern Office Interior Designs for Productivity

The goal of contemporary workplace interior design in 2026 is to make people’s jobs easier rather than more difficult. Crowded areas and useless décor are becoming less common in offices.

  • A major goal is to reduce clutter. Employees can focus better and experience less stress during the day when there are fewer interruptions.
  • Offices with a clean layout feel more open and structured. It’s a lot easier to move around and collaborate when everything has a place.
  • With functional aesthetics, the office is both aesthetically pleasing and functional. Comfort and everyday use are taken into consideration when selecting furniture, lighting, and layouts.
  • In general, contemporary office interior design concepts emphasise straightforward design decisions that promote efficiency while maintaining a serene and cosy work environment.

Smart Layouts for Small Office

With a small office, an intelligent design could make the space seem much larger:

  • Optimize the use of space: Make sure that walkways and hallways are not congested.
  • Multi-functional furniture: Desks with storage and folding tables maximize space functionality.
  • Collaborative zones & private areas: Collaborative zones encourage teamwork, while other areas offer privacy when it’s needed.

Office Furniture Design Trends for Employee Comfort

Comfortable seating encourages everyone to be productive:

  • Ergonomic chairs: Promoting improved postures and reducing strains.
  • Modular desks: Easy to reconfigure to suit the dynamics of teams.
  • Durables: The furniture will not deteriorate or become obsolete.

Office Partition Design Ideas for Flexible Workspaces

Partitions now are emphasized on flexibility and openness:

  • Mix open layouts with private cabins: Encourages both teamwork and concentration.
  • Glass, wood, and modular partitions: The ability to divide without being closed in.
  • Acoustic and visual balance: Noise reduction while regaining the unity of the office.

Office Decoration Ideas to Improve Your Working Space

Small details matter and make great differences, such as: 

  • Good lighting: It illuminates the room, ensuring greater focus. 
  • Textures & finishes: Character without clutter. 
  • Natural Elements: Plants or wood will provide the benefit of freshness and warmth.

Office Interior Design Checklist for 2026

Before deciding on your office design, here are a few things that this quick checklist may help you remember:

  • Layout planning: The layout should facilitate the natural flow of movements and of work.
  • Furniture: Choose comfortable and durable furniture.
  • Lighting: You can go for both natural and artificial lighting.
  • Materials: Materials should be selected in such a way that they are long-lasting and easy to maintain
  • Scalability: Design to expand and/or change without extensive modifications.

FAQs

1. What are the key elements of modern office interior design?

The key elements are clean layouts, good lighting, comfortable furniture, and spaces that don’t feel trapped. Modern offices focus more on how people work than on how the space looks on paper.

2. How can I make a small office interior look bigger?

Use light colours, keep furniture minimal, and avoid bulky partitions. Glass panels, mirrors, and smart storage help a lot more than people think.

3. Which furniture is best for office interiors?

Comfortable and practical furniture is ideal for office interiors. Chairs with good back support, desks with enough legroom, and storage that doesn’t eat up space.

4. What colors are suitable for corporate office interiors?

Neutral shades like white, grey, or beige work well, with one or two accent colours is for personality. Too many colours can get distracting fast.

5. How do I design an ergonomic workspace for employees?

Focus on posture. Prefer adjustable chairs, proper desk height, screen at eye level, and natural light. These small changes make a big difference every day.

6. Should I choose open-plan or cabin-style office design?

It depends on your work culture. Open plans are great for teamwork, while cabins work better for focused or private tasks. Many offices now mix both.

8. What are the latest trends in office interior design for 2026?

Flexible layouts, more greenery, quiet zones, and designs that support hybrid work. Offices are becoming more people-friendly, not just work-focused.

9. How can I create a creative office interior for startups?

To make your office creative, keep it flexible and fun. Use open spaces, movable furniture, bold accents, and breakout zones where teams can brainstorm or relax.

10. What are eco-friendly options for office interior design?

Use sustainable materials, energy-efficient lighting, natural ventilation, and indoor plants. Even small eco-friendly choices add up over time.
